Crabgrass Removal in Aiken, SC
Crabgrass removal services focus on eliminating this invasive weed from residential lawns and landscaped areas. Crabgrass often appears during warm months and can quickly spread, competing with desirable grasses and plants for nutrients, water, and sunlight. These services typically include targeted removal methods, such as hand-pulling or specialized herbicides, to effectively control existing crabgrass and prevent its regrowth. Property owners may request this service for entire lawns, flower beds, or specific problem areas where crabgrass tends to thrive, helping to maintain a healthy and aesthetically pleasing yard.
Before requesting crabgrass removal,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the infestation and the best approach for their specific landscape. It’s helpful to consider whether the goal is to remove existing crabgrass or to establish ongoing prevention strategies. Additionally, understanding the timing of the treatment-particularly during the active growing season-can influence the effectiveness of the service. Proper preparation, such as mowing or watering schedules, may also be recommended to optimize results and support the overall health of the lawn or garden.

Crabgrass Removal Questions
What is crabgrass? Crabgrass is a fast-growing weed that appears in lawns, often during warm months, and can quickly spread if not managed.
Why remove crabgrass? Removing crabgrass helps maintain a healthy, uniform lawn and prevents it from competing with desirable grass types.
When is the best time for crabgrass removal? The best time to address crabgrass is during early growth stages in spring or early summer before it becomes widespread.
What methods are used for crabgrass removal? Methods include manual removal, targeted herbicide application, and lawn care practices to prevent future growth.
